Sam Groth Faces Scrutiny Over Taxpayer-Funded Car Ride: What's Happening?

Former tennis star and current Deputy Victorian Liberal leader Sam Groth is under fire following allegations of misusing a taxpayer-funded vehicle. The controversy revolves around an incident that allegedly occurred after the Australian Open in January 2024, raising questions about the use of public resources and prompting calls for accountability. Recent Updates: Groth Responds to Misuse Allegations

The core of the controversy stems from claims that Sam Groth misused a taxpayer-funded car to travel home from the Australian Open. According to reports, Groth allegedly used a chauffeured vehicle belonging to his colleague, Liberal MP Georgie Crozier, to transport himself and his wife to their home on the Mornington Peninsula.

Official Statements and Reports

  • Sam Groth's Response: Sam Groth has responded to the allegations, denying any misuse of taxpayer funds. He is facing calls to step down as deputy leader of the Victorian Liberal Party.
  • Georgie Crozier's Disappointment: Liberal MP Georgie Crozier has publicly expressed her "incredibly disappointed" with the situation, demanding answers from Groth and the party's leadership.
  • Party Investigation: Senior party figures have asked Groth to explain his actions, indicating an internal review of the matter.

Sam Groth: From Tennis Ace to Political Hot Shot

Before entering the political arena, Sam Groth was a well-known figure in Australian sports. His career as a professional tennis player saw him achieve considerable success, capturing the hearts of many Australians.

Tennis Career Highlights

Groth's tennis career was marked by several notable achievements:

  • ATP World Tour: He competed on the ATP World Tour, participating in prestigious tournaments around the globe.
  • Grand Slam Appearances: Groth made multiple appearances at Grand Slam events, including the Australian Open, Wimbledon, and the US Open.
  • Davis Cup Representation: He represented Australia in the Davis Cup, contributing to the nation's success in the international team competition.
  • World Record Serve: Groth once held the record for the fastest serve ever recorded in professional tennis, showcasing his powerful game.
